======================================================
注:本文源代码点此下载
======================================================
昨天遇到了ajax的中文乱码问题,在网上google了一下,搜索的结果不少,可是都没能帮助我解决乱码的问题。我遇到的乱码问题很是怪,在有些机器上不乱码,有些就乱码。不出现乱码的机器是xp系统安装了vs2003又安装了vs2005,或者是win2003的。
后来因为要做一个功能,要向配置文件里写东西。看到
我用的gb2312的编码,我把responseencoding改为utf-8就不乱码了, requestencoding没改。
不改 requestencoding带来了问题,post数据的时候,写进数据库的是乱码。
于是改了 requestencoding为utf-8
问题又来了,因为一个页面用了一个网友的js的特效——div样式的窗口,加载页面的时候提示脚本错误,这个div也ajax了。
是 requestencoding来了的问题。
现在我还在研究是什么原因出的问题。
为了避免脚本错误,在web.config加入
节局部设置
没出现问题。
======================================================
在最后,我邀请大家参加新浪APP,就是新浪免费送大家的一个空间,支持PHP+MySql,免费二级域名,免费域名绑定 这个是我邀请的地址,您通过这个链接注册即为我的好友,并获赠云豆500个,价值5元哦!短网址是http://t.cn/SXOiLh我创建的小站每天访客已经达到2000+了,每天挂广告赚50+元哦,呵呵,饭钱不愁了,\(^o^)/